How Collaborative Word Cloud Improves Classroom Engagement
Collaborative Word Cloud is like a secret ingredient for making classrooms more engaging and exciting. Here’s how it works:
- Active Participation: It encourages every student to add their words or ideas in real time, making them active contributors to the class discussion. It’s like a digital show-and-tell.
- Visual Learning: Students can see important ideas taking shape right before their eyes. It’s like turning lessons into colorful, interactive art.
- Teamwork: When students work together to create a word cloud, it’s like a team sport for the mind. They talk, share ideas, and learn from each other.
- Creativity and Critical Thinking: It sparks creativity. Students pick the words that matter most, like a fun puzzle. They also learn to think critically because they have to decide what’s most important for the word cloud.
Top 3 Collaborative Word Cloud Tools
Here are the top 3 collaborative word cloud tools for the classroom:
AhaSlides:
AhaSlides Collaborative Word Cloud offers a range of interactive features, including the ability for students to contribute words and ideas in real time. Teachers can display the evolving word cloud for the class to see, making lessons dynamic and engaging.
Mentimeter:
Mentimeter offers a user-friendly interface that makes participation easy. Students can instantly see their contributions, fostering active involvement in class discussions.
Wordart.com:
Wordart is a straightforward and customizable tool that allows for the easy generation of word clouds. Users can also customize the appearance of the word cloud, choosing from various fonts, colors, and layouts to create a visually appealing representation.
